VGT proper operation?

Since doing the up grades to my rig (check sig), I've been watching VGT operation(scan gauge ll). I've noticed that on cold mornings, first start, it would read 85. As I drive it change as it should but on every restart it would only read about 66-78 at a stop light. Is this because the turbo is aleady warmed up? Before all the repairs turbo would never hardy whistle at idle. I have been using Archoil since my repair and have noticed a big change in how the truck idles and how turbo responds. Is Archoil cleaning the turbo and injectors? Thx.

The VGT % is a desired reading and not what the solenoid is actually doing

the vgt is used to restrict exhaust flow at cold start to help aid engine warmup.

vgt% is what the pcm is commanding the the vgt to do. that doesnt mean it really happening as there is no direct feed back from the vgt to the pcm to varifiy it.

desired would be the expected value we see in things like egrdc#, icpdsd or msfdsd pids.
vgt is an accuator only there for there is only a commanded value. the pcm doesnt desire to see anything.
now to head this off too, egr has 2 circuts one is the accuator the other is the vref for position.
